在Windows系统中,命令提示符(cmd)是一个强大的工具,它允许用户通过一系列命令行指令来执行各种操作。对于数据库管理员或开发者来说,使用cmd命令行快速查找数据库名是一项非常实用的技能。下面,我将详细介绍一些实用的技巧,帮助你更高效地在cmd中查找数据库名。
一、使用SQL Server Management Studio (SSMS)
虽然SSMS是SQL Server的图形界面管理工具,但它也提供了一些命令行功能。以下是如何使用SSMS在cmd中查找数据库名的方法:
- 打开SSMS,连接到你的SQL Server实例。
- 在查询窗口中输入以下命令:
SELECT name FROM sys.databases; - 执行查询后,你将看到所有数据库的列表。
二、使用SQLCMD工具
SQLCMD是SQL Server提供的命令行工具,它可以用来执行SQL命令。以下是如何使用SQLCMD在cmd中查找数据库名的方法:
- 打开cmd窗口。
- 输入以下命令并按Enter:
sqlcmd -S 你的服务器实例名称 -E - 在SQLCMD提示符下,输入以下命令:
SELECT name FROM sys.databases; - 执行查询后,你将看到所有数据库的列表。
三、使用T-SQL查询
如果你熟悉T-SQL,可以直接在SQL Server的查询窗口中执行以下命令来查找数据库名:
SELECT name FROM sys.databases;
四、使用PowerShell
PowerShell是Windows操作系统的脚本编写和命令行shell,它提供了丰富的命令行功能。以下是如何使用PowerShell在cmd中查找数据库名的方法:
- 打开PowerShell窗口。
- 输入以下命令并按Enter:
Invoke-Sqlcmd -ServerInstance 你的服务器实例名称 -Query "SELECT name FROM sys.databases;" - 执行查询后,你将看到所有数据库的列表。
五、使用Windows资源管理器
如果你只是想快速查看数据库列表,可以使用Windows资源管理器来查找数据库名:
- 打开Windows资源管理器。
- 在地址栏中输入以下路径:
\\你的服务器实例名称\pipe\sql\default - 你将看到所有数据库的列表。
总结
通过以上方法,你可以在cmd中快速查找数据库名。这些技巧可以帮助你更高效地管理数据库,提高工作效率。希望这篇文章能对你有所帮助!
